Exemplo n.º 1
0
        /// <summary>
        /// Actualiza a registro de la tabla MVehiculo.
        /// </summary>
        public void Update(ENT_MVehiculo x_oENT_MVehiculo)
        {
            SqlParameter[] parameters = null;
            try{
                parameters = new SqlParameter[]
                {
                    new SqlParameter("@MVEH_nId", x_oENT_MVehiculo.MVEH_nId),
                    new SqlParameter("@MVEH_cPlaca", x_oENT_MVehiculo.MVEH_cPlaca),
                    new SqlParameter("@MVEH_cTPropiedad", x_oENT_MVehiculo.MVEH_cTPropiedad),
                    new SqlParameter("@MVEH_nIdMProveedor", x_oENT_MVehiculo.MVEH_nIdMProveedor),
                    new SqlParameter("@MVEH_nIdMModelo", x_oENT_MVehiculo.MVEH_nIdMModelo),
                    new SqlParameter("@MVEH_lActivo", x_oENT_MVehiculo.MVEH_lActivo),
                    new SqlParameter("@MVEH_nUsrReg", x_oENT_MVehiculo.MVEH_nUsrReg),
                    new SqlParameter("@MVEH_dFechReg", x_oENT_MVehiculo.MVEH_dFechReg),
                    new SqlParameter("@MVEH_nUsrMod", x_oENT_MVehiculo.MVEH_nUsrMod),
                    new SqlParameter("@MVEH_dFechMod", x_oENT_MVehiculo.MVEH_dFechMod)
                };
            }
            catch (Exception ex)
            {
                throw controlarExcepcion("Error de asignación de parámetros.", ex);
            }

            try{
                ejecutarNonQuery("spMVehiculo_Update", parameters);
            }
            catch (Exception ex)
            {
                throw controlarExcepcion("Error de operación de acceso a datos.", ex);
            }
        }
Exemplo n.º 2
0
        /// <summary>
        /// Selecciona una registro de la tabla MVehiculo por su primary key.
        /// </summary>
        public ENT_MVehiculo Select(int MVEH_nId)
        {
            SqlParameter[] parameters = null;
            try{
                parameters = new SqlParameter[]
                {
                    new SqlParameter("@MVEH_nId", MVEH_nId)
                };
            }
            catch (Exception ex)
            {
                throw controlarExcepcion("Error de asignación de parámetros.", ex);
            }

            ENT_MVehiculo objMVehiculo = new ENT_MVehiculo();

            try{
                objMVehiculo = GetEntity <ENT_MVehiculo>("spMVehiculo_Select", parameters);
            }
            catch (Exception ex)
            {
                throw controlarExcepcion("Error de operación de acceso a datos.", ex);
            }
            return(objMVehiculo);
        }
Exemplo n.º 3
0
 /// <summary>
 /// Actualiza a registro de la tabla MVehiculo.
 /// </summary>
 public void Update(ENT_MVehiculo x_oENT_MVehiculo)
 {
     new DAL_MVehiculo().Update(x_oENT_MVehiculo);
 }
Exemplo n.º 4
0
 /// <summary>
 /// Guarda un registro de la tabla MVehiculo.
 /// </summary>
 public void Insert(ENT_MVehiculo x_oENT_MVehiculo)
 {
     new DAL_MVehiculo().Insert(x_oENT_MVehiculo);
 }